The Studies For Video Watermarking Algorithms Based On Features

With the rapid development of multimedia technology,the video plays a more and more important role in our life,work and study.In recent years,the cases for video piracy and content tampering are increasing.It is urgent to protect the video copyright.To solve the problem of video copyright protection,the video watermarking algorithms with effectiveness,invisibility and robustness have been proposed.However,there are only a few video watermarking algorithms based on features.In this thesis,two video watermarking algorithms based on features for copyright protection are proposed.1.The video watermarking algorithm based on region selection is proposed to balance the robustness and invisibility.Firstly,an improved structure tensor operator is used to select the best 4 × 4 block as the embedding block of watermark information.Secondly,the luminance channel of I frame is chosen to embed the watermark information.The selected 4 × 4 pixel block is operated using DCT(Discrete Cosine Transform)and SVD(Singular value decomposition).Finally,the watermark information is embedded into the video by the odd-even rule in the algorithm.Experimental results show that the watermarking algorithm can protect the video copyright well.The PSNR of each frame is greater than 45,and the SSIM is at least 0.99.At the same time,the watermark extraction rate is more than 90% after some common attacks,such as compression,noise,filtering,and frame dropping,frame adding.2.An adaptive video watermarking algorithm is proposed with different embedding intensity according to different texture and brightness in the video.Firstly,each 16 × 16 macro block is transformed into two levels of DWT(Discrete Wavelet Transform).Secondly,the low frequency components of DWT are transformed by DCT to reduce the impact of embedding process.Finally,the watermark information is embedded into the video by the calculated adaptive quantization step size and odd-even rule.Adaptive embedding quantization step is calculated for macro block based on Radon transform.Experimental results show that our watermarking algorithm is invisible and robust against common attacks.
